I think that if you concentrated on where the does will be, the bucks will follow. I think that their pattern changes w/different food source availability. I'm not sure if the weather changes as dramatically as here in Wi. But the food source is dictated by the weather. What you find in Oct/early Nov. will not be found in late Dec. Heavy snow, strong winds, etc. I think play a part of where the deer will go. I hunt trails, mainly the place between bedding areas & food areas. They can be predictible as to the area they cross, whether or not they want to come under your stand to play is just luck.

I have studied deer for over 40 years. When I hunt them I know exactly why and what kind of trail and tactic I'm going to use. I hunt food at certain times of the year and I hunt cover at certain times of the year. It all depends on what I'm after. In the grand scheme of things, in the most general sense, It's always about food and cover. A lot of times evenings = food and mornings = cover. BTW, where I hunt food is where ever the deer is standing. Everything is food to them. They just happen to prefer one over the other or the other over the one. That's for you to figure out![:-]
